The Warm-Up #33 from ScrapFit is SMEAR & SMUDGE SOME PAINT.  Well I certainly used some paint! 
  • I used my new bottle of Gesso paint.  I had bought it a few days before.  I opened the bottle and poured some paint onto my cardstock.  I then used my paintbrush to move the paint across the paper.  I then had this idea to use some beads in the wet paint on one end of the pushed paint. 
  • I let this dry for a few days (and I had to work at my real job).  Then I looked for some photos taken near water.  Well that proved more difficult than I thought.  I found this one from last April when our family went to Fort Myers in Florida.  The photo is mostly of the walkway with the water next to it.  My husband and kids are at the end of the dock.
  • I cut some strips of blue paper from my scraps.  I used several of my border punches to put a pretty edge on each of them.
  • I layered these strips behind the photo.  I got his idea from friend scrapbookers.
  • I added a title/journal box.
  • I wanted some other color so I added the two reddish birds to the bottom of the page.
  • Voila, my LO was finished.
